rep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Rainbows! 4.1.0 - minor internal cleanups
2011-04-26
Eric Wong
revactor: do n
o
t recom
m
end
,
upstr
e
a
m is d
o
rma
n
t
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
stre
a
m
_
f
i
l
e:
hide internals
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
m
ake
all concurrency options us
e
5
0
by de
f
a
ult
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
t
h
rea
d
_timeout: annotate as
mu
c
h as
possible
commit
|
commitdiff
|
tree
2011-04-21
Eric Wo
n
g
in
c
rease RLIMIT_N
P
ROC for thre
a
d-crazy folks
commit
|
commitdiff
|
tree
2011-04-21
Eric
Wo
n
g
http
_
s
e
rver: att
e
mpt
to increase RLIMIT
_
NOF
I
LE
commit
|
commitdiff
|
tree
2011-04-21
Er
i
c W
o
ng
thread_t
i
m
e
out: doc
u
ment Thread
.
pass usage
commit
|
commitdiff
|
tree
2011-04-21
Eric
Wong
join
_
thre
a
ds: workaround
b
l
ocking
accept() is
s
u
e
s
commit
|
commitdiff
|
tree
2011-04-21
E
ric
W
on
g
bump depend
e
ncy to Unico
r
n 3
.
6
.
0
commit
|
commitdiff
|
tree
2011-04-19
E
r
i
c Wong
htt
p
_server: less hacky loading of concurrency model
commit
|
commitdiff
|
tree
2011-04-11
Eric
W
o
n
g
t:
o
n
l
y
e
nable Revac
t
or test
s
unde
r
1
.
9
.
2 for now
commit
|
commitdiff
|
tree
2011-04-11
E
r
ic Wong
epoll: fixes for Ruby 1
.
9
.
3d
e
v
commit
|
commitdiff
|
tree
2011-04-11
Eric Wong
t
h
read_
t
ime
o
u
t
: rewrite for safet
y
commit
|
commitdiff
|
tree
2011-04-10
Eric
W
ong
thread_poo
l
: get used
o
f dead thread_
j
o
i
n method
commit
|
commitdiff
|
tree
2011-03-22
Eric Wong
q
u
e
u
e_poo
l
: switch to
i
v
ar
s
t
o protect
intern
a
ls
commit
|
commitdiff
|
tree
2011-03-22
E
ric Wong
thread_p
o
ol+thread
_
spawn
:
u
p
date docum
e
ntation
commit
|
commitdiff
|
tree
2011-03-21
Eric Wong
s
implify LISTENERS closing
commit
|
commitdiff
|
tree
2011-03-20
Eric W
o
ng
fix var
i
ous
w
a
rnings
with "chec
k
-warni
n
gs" target
commit
|
commitdiff
|
tree
2011-03-20
Eric Won
g
pkg
.
mk: new task for checking Ruby warnings
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
fiber/io: fix b
r
oken call
t
o
Kgio
.
t
r
y
write
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
Rainbows!
3
.
2
.
0
- trying to
s
e
nd f
i
les to slow c
l
ients
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
bump Unicorn dependency to 3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Eric Won
g
doc:
u
pdate Static_F
i
les
for ne
w
sendfile gem
commit
|
commitdiff
|
tree
2011-03-10
E
ric
Wong
switch
f
rom
IO
#
s
e
n
d
file
_
nonbloc
k
to IO#
t
rysendfile
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
test_isolate: bump
dependencies
commit
|
commitdiff
|
tree
2011-02-28
Eric
Wong
use IO#wait ins
t
ea
d
of IO
.
select fo
r
single readers
commit
|
commitdiff
|
tree
2011-02-16
Eric Wo
n
g
READ
M
E:
cla
r
i
fy license
terms and ver
s
ions
commit
|
commitdiff
|
tree
2011-02-15
E
ric Wong
t
e
st
s
:
u
pdates for
c
ramp 0
.
12
commit
|
commitdiff
|
tree
2011-02-11
Er
i
c Wo
n
g
Rainbows! 3
.
1
.
0 - mino
r
up
d
ates
commit
|
commitdiff
|
tree
2011-02-11
Eric Wong
pkg
.
mk:
update to the
l
atest
commit
|
commitdiff
|
tree
2011-02-11
Er
i
c
W
ong
r
e
verse
_
proxy: docume
n
t a
s
"not r
e
ady for
p
roduction"
commit
|
commitdiff
|
tree
2011-02-08
Eri
c
Wong
R
e
vert t/bin/u
n
u
s
ed
_
liste
n
simpl
i
fication
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
new
t
e
s
t for
o
ptional :poo
l
_
s
i
ze
h
andling
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
gemspec: rem
o
ve unne
c
essa
r
y state
m
ents
commit
|
commitdiff
|
tree
2011-02-08
E
ric Wong
doc: rd
o
c cleanups and fixes
commit
|
commitdiff
|
tree
2011-02-06
Eri
c
Wo
n
g
m
i
nim
i
ze &block us
a
ge for yi
e
ld
commit
|
commitdiff
|
tree
2011-02-06
Eric Wong
kil
l
some u
n
necessary &block
u
s
age
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
W
o
ng
*epoll
:
ref
a
c
t
or common loop
c
ode
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*
e
poll: co
n
sol
i
date re-
r
un logic
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
w
r
i
t
er_th
r
e
a
d_pool:
n
eedless u
s
e
o
f Ar
r
a
y#map
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
l
ess expensive QUIT pro
c
essing
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c Wong
h
ttp
_
se
r
ver:
k
il
l
a
warnin
g
commit
|
commitdiff
|
tree
2011-02-05
Eric W
o
ng
bump require
d
Unicorn dependency for K
g
io
commit
|
commitdiff
|
tree
2011-02-05
Eric
W
ong
b
u
mp wrongdoc devel
o
pment depende
n
cy
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
rename XAcceptEpoll to XEpoll
commit
|
commitdiff
|
tree
2011-02-05
E
ric Wong
test_is
o
late: use latest Unicorn
commit
|
commitdiff
|
tree
2011-02-05
E
r
ic Won
g
t
e
s
ts:
r
eplace severa
l
se
d
invocations wi
t
h ed
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c Wong
revers
e
_proxy: smal
l
reorganizatio
n
commit
|
commitdiff
|
tree
2011-02-05
Eri
c
Wong
r
e
v
erse_pro
x
y:
properly rea
d
IPv6 addrese
s
in upstreams
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
epoll
:
handle EINTR properly i
n
Ruby-
s
pace
commit
|
commitdiff
|
tree
2011-02-04
Eric Wong
test_isolate: only loa
d
sleepy_peng
u
in und
e
r Linux
commit
|
commitdiff
|
tree
2011-02-04
E
r
ic Wong
t/bin/unused
_
li
s
t
e
n: simplify this
commit
|
commitdiff
|
tree
2011-02-02
Eric Wong
preliminary
reverse proxy Rack appli
c
ation
commit
|
commitdiff
|
tree
2011-01-31
Eric
Wong
cool
i
o/client:
o
n_write_complete trig
g
e
rs read
commit
|
commitdiff
|
tree
2011-01-27
Eric Wong
test for client_max_body_size bein
g
z
e
ro
commit
|
commitdiff
|
tree
2011-01-26
Eric W
o
ng
epoll
/
cl
i
ent: avo
i
d unn
e
cessary
Epoll#set c
a
lls
commit
|
commitdiff
|
tree
2011-01-26
Eric
W
ong
GNUma
k
efile: onl
y
enable epoll-ba
s
ed models in Lin
u
x
commit
|
commitdiff
|
tree
2011-01-25
E
ric Wong
initial XAccept
E
poll concu
r
r
e
ncy mod
e
l
commit
|
commitdiff
|
tree
2011-01-25
Eric Wong
e
p
o
ll
/
client: t
h
r
e
ad-safety fo
r
writ
e
que
u
ing
commit
|
commitdiff
|
tree
2011-01-25
E
r
i
c
Wo
n
g
e
poll:
m
a
k
e Epoll
.
qu
i
t m
o
re reusable
commit
|
commitdiff
|
tree
2011-01-24
Eric W
o
n
g
neverblock: fix app
_
call und
e
r 1
.
8
.
7
commit
|
commitdiff
|
tree
2011-01-24
Eric Wong
clea
r
LISTENERS ar
r
ay on
c
lose
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ll/clien
t
:
minor o
p
timi
z
a
t
i
o
n
commit
|
commitdiff
|
tree
2011-01-22
E
r
ic Wong
ev_core:
f
orce input to be given to app_c
a
ll
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ll/client: factor ou
t
on_close method
commit
|
commitdiff
|
tree
2011-01-22
Eric Wo
n
g
epoll/c
l
ient: remove u
n
use
d
client
commit
|
commitdiff
|
tree
2011-01-22
Eric
W
ong
extract common tasks to pkg
.
mk to simplify our makef
i
l
e
commit
|
commitdiff
|
tree
2011-01-22
Eric
Wong
e
p
oll
:
reduce expiration calls and Time objects
commit
|
commitdiff
|
tree
2011-01-22
Er
i
c W
o
ng
ev_co
r
e
:
garba
g
e
re
d
u
c
tion
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
epoll: use
n
ewer sleepy_pen
g
uin
commit
|
commitdiff
|
tree
2011-01-22
Eric Wong
max
_
b
o
dy: disa
b
le
f
or epoll
commit
|
commitdiff
|
tree
2011-01-21
Eric Wong
d
oc: git
.
bogom
i
ps
.
org =>
bogo
m
ips
.
org
commit
|
commitdiff
|
tree
2011-01-21
Eric Wong
e
p
oll:
use
s
leepy_p
e
nguin default size for epoll_wait
commit
|
commitdiff
|
tree
2011-01-20
Eric
Wong
e
p
oll: c
l
ose epoll descriptor on
g
rac
e
ful s
h
ut
d
own
commit
|
commitdiff
|
tree
2011-01-20
Eric Wo
n
g
remo
v
e s
u
pport for S
u
nshowers
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
epoll: ig
n
o
r
e
ECONNRE
S
ET error
s
commit
|
commitdiff
|
tree
2011-01-20
Er
i
c Wong
ev_core: si
m
plify setup ste
p
s
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
mer
g
e rack_input
i
nt
o
proce
s
s_c
l
ient
commit
|
commitdiff
|
tree
2011-01-20
Er
i
c
Wong
e
v_core: localize 413 error constant
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
r
e
move
unused 416 error constants/excepti
o
ns
commit
|
commitdiff
|
tree
2011-01-20
Eric Wo
n
g
dev_fd_r
e
sponse
:
g
a
r
bage
r
educt
i
on
commit
|
commitdiff
|
tree
2011-01-20
Eric W
o
ng
dev_f
d
_re
s
ponse: do not send
ch
u
nks to 1
.
0 clients
commit
|
commitdiff
|
tree
2011-01-20
Er
i
c Wong
t0035: kgio-pi
p
e-response works ever
y
whe
r
e
commit
|
commitdiff
|
tree
2011-01-20
Eric Won
g
t002
3
: use skip_mode
l
s
h
elpe
r
commit
|
commitdiff
|
tree
2011-01-20
Eric Wong
remove suppo
r
t for X-Ra
i
nbows-*
h
e
ade
r
s
commit
|
commitdiff
|
tree
2011-01-19
Eric Wong
i
nitial edge-
t
riggered epo
l
l model
commit
|
commitdiff
|
tree
2011-01-19
Er
i
c Won
g
tests: content-
m
d5
t
ests shut down co
n
nection
commit
|
commitdiff
|
tree
2011-01-17
Eric Wong
ev_core: reus
e
b
u
ffer
to avoid GC thrashing
commit
|
commitdiff
|
tree
2011-01-14
Eric Wong
t0050:
impro
v
e test rel
i
ability
commit
|
commitdiff
|
tree
2011-01-14
Eric Wong
t
ests: bump rack-fiber_pool ver
s
ion
t
o 0
.
9
.
1
commit
|
commitdiff
|
tree
2011-01-12
Eri
c
Wong
Rainbows! 3
.
0
.
0 - ser
v
in
g
the
fastest
a
pps to
s
l
ow
.
.
.
commit
|
commitdiff
|
tree
2011-01-12
Er
i
c Wong
add w
r
ite-on-close test fr
o
m
Unicorn
commit
|
commitdiff
|
tree
2011-01-12
Eric Won
g
e
v
e
n
t_machine: buffer read
s
when
w
aiting for a
s
yn
c
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eri
c
Wong
e
v
e
nt_machine/cli
e
n
t: rename
i
var for consistency wi
t
h
.
.
.
commit
|
commitdiff
|
tree
2011-01-11
Eric Wo
n
g
event
_
machi
n
e/client: re
m
ove u
n
used :
b
od
y
acc
e
ssor
commit
|
commitdiff
|
tree
2011-01-11
E
r
ic Won
g
c
o
olio: enable a
s
ync
.
callback fo
r
one-sh
o
t
body responses
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
ra
i
n
b
ows/coo
l
io
/
cl
i
ent:
se
t
LO
O
P constant in m
o
dule
commit
|
commitdiff
|
tree
2011-01-08
Eric
W
o
n
g
coo
l
io/client:
s
ma
l
l op
t
imizations
commit
|
commitdiff
|
tree
2011-01-08
Eri
c
Wong
coolio_thread_*: lazy load
Rainbows::Cooli
o
::Clien
t
commit
|
commitdiff
|
tree
2011-01-08
Eric Wong
redi
r
ect unexpe
c
te
d
tes
t
outpu
t
to /dev/n
u
l
l
commit
|
commitdiff
|
tree
next